Houston Texans rookie Kayden McDonald sits out practice with ankle injury

Houston Texans defensive tackle Kayden McDonald faces uncertainty for his NFL debut this Sunday against the Buffalo Bills at NRG Stadium. After participating in a limited capacity during Wednesday's practice, the second-round draft pick did not participate in Thursday's session due to an ankle injury. His status for the opening week matchup remains undetermined as the team monitors his recovery. While head coach DeMeco Ryans has depth on the defensive line, McDonald is expected to provide key contributions against the run and assist in applying pressure on Buffalo quarterback Josh Allen. The Texans enter the game aiming for a third consecutive win over the Bills in a matchup between two teams with AFC playoff aspirations.
